We are seeking a Recruiting Coordinator to support a fast paced and creative, 2-person Sales Team specialized in the Aerospace, Automotive, Environmental, and Innovative sectors. This position will offer growth potential to move you into a client-facing or recruiter trajectory, depending on performance and preference.
As the Recruiting Coordinator you will be responsible for coordinating interviews with numerous clients, providing seamless candidate experience from interview to hire, and any administrative support to a highly dedicated Sales Team. The right candidate is collaborative, communicative, organized and committed to providing excellent service.

Responsibilities:
- Work with hiring teams to schedule, coordinate, and confirm multi-stage interviews, including phone screens, conference calls, video calls and in-person interviews.
- Monitor email box and respond to all inquiries within a timely manner.
- Responsible for accurate, organized, and detailed weekly Excel reports to update hiring managers on candidate search.
- Manage day-to-day, weekly, monthly, quarterly, and annual ongoing projects in project management software, Asana.
- Participate in calls with clients and simultaneously complete notes during client calls.
- Ownership over candidate submissions, tracking progress of the candidate process, and communicating any changes or important updates to the sales team.
- Collect, organize, distribute, and archive the appropriate documents associated with each round of interviews to both the candidates and internal interview team.
- Responsible for accurate information in our Applicant Tracking System, always maintaining a high level of data integrity and confidentiality.
- Creatively solve scheduling conflicts and help to expedite the interview process when faced with roadblocks.
- Will work on note transcription and adjust job descriptions as needed.
- Manage internal reports and documents on both Excel and Word that assist with Sales productivity.
- Ensure first-class experience throughout the interview, hiring, and onboarding process by being the bridge between the candidate, recruiter, hiring team, and People Operations.
- Communicate status updates to the Sales Executives, Recruiters, and other necessary team members.
